Important After-Repair Evaluation Procedures

One of the most vital aspects of aftercare following collision repair is completing a comprehensive assessment after leaving the body shop. Our specialists at our Plano facility suggest that you examine the following areas:

  • Paint and Bodywork: Examine for color matching in coating and verify there are zero imperfections
  • Glass and Seals: Verify that glass operate properly and door seals are properly fitted
  • Mechanical Components: Verify that suspension work as designed
  • Alignment and Suspension: Request a suspension inspection to reduce suspension problems

Regular Vehicle Maintenance Routine After Collision

Implementing a regular care schedule is one of the most important aspects of aftercare in our community. After your collision repair, we advise following these critical care intervals:

  • After 500 miles: Re-inspect all repair work for problems
  • Early aftercare: Complete a comprehensive review of mechanical systems
  • Quarterly: Check for deterioration on new panels
  • Annually: Book a comprehensive vehicle inspection
